Introduction

Hey MobaFire! My IGN is ElderPeko and I am a Coach/Analyst for Emerald eSports Ireland!

Morgana was originally one of my favorite champions for Mid-Lane when I originally started playing, but she has transitioned to be much better suited for the support role. Morgana excels against teams that are very reliant on crowd control. She generally does not have many poor matchups in the bottom lane, which is why she had such an impact in Season 4

This guide is written assuming that you, as a Support player, have a general idea of your positioning and responsibilities in team fights as well as in laning phase.

Laning Phase

In lane you should feel free to choose Ignite or Exhaust.

Ignite is favorable in matchups where you know you are going to be the aggressor, and are playing against squishier champions like Sona, Janna, or Nami to benefit from the healing reduction.

Take Exhaust if you feel like you will not have much kill potential on your enemy laners, or if you think you need it for another threat on the enemy team. (i.e. Master Yi, Udyr, etc.)

In laning phase, a well placed Dark Binding is what is going to seal the deal for early kills. Harassing can become a problem for Morgana if you are not comfortable with her attack animation as it has a fairly long wind-up. Take charge of the bush and punish anyone who comes in range of a free Dark Binding Tormented Shadow combo.

Once you hit level 4 you should be able to have a lot of pressure on the enemy laners assuming you are comfortable landing your skillshot!

Dragon Control

Generally, if your team is even or ahead, you will be contesting dragons fairly early. Your job as Morgana will be to gain adequate vision of the enemy jungle to understand their positioning. Let your team react know so they can react appropriately to the signs of early enemy grouping.

If you are playing Morgana from the Blue side you should place your wards at the enemy Blue buff, behind the wolf camp/banana bush in midlane, and buy a pink ward for the river itself (This will mitigate stealth champions impact on the dragon fight, and will also make sure the dragon area is free of wards).

Remember to always cast Black Shield on yourself when facechecking a brush to get vision, especially in the river

If you are playing Morgana from the Purple side, you should place your wards behind the enemy Red buff, in the Tri-brush, and again, place a pink ward in the river itself.

Team Fighting

Team fighting is fairly simple as Morgana, and often times you can be the one to iniate a fight with a well placed Dark Binding. Prepare yourself for the upcoming fight and be ready to cast Black Shield on the target that is most vulnerable to CC. If you have completed Zhonya's Hourglass you should be able to walk into the center of the enemy team, and use Soul Shackles followed by Zhonya's Hourglass. After this combo has ticked, the fight will generally be dispersing, and you should tend to the wounds of your ADC or pick off any remaining enemies with Dark Binding
